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2716 9118700 07
0113474 017 5938857
0113474 017 5938857
88992 39869 60410936982 10518
All about undefined
Interested in learning more?
0113474 017 5938857
88992 39869 60410936982 10518
See more
17 37
1847498 7322651271 32 315
See more
26661904094 59790494
045 614624 4809 2855 7571
See more